Brian Stacey

It is with deep sadness that we advise of the passing of one of our cricket legends, Brian Stacey.

“Stace”, as he was fondly known, was a formidable opening bowler for Dunnington in the late 60s right through to the 90s, his opening bowling partnership with Steve Whittaker was the envy of clubs far and wide and still talked about in local cricketing circles to this day.

A black and white photograph of a cricket team posing together outdoors, wearing traditional cricket attire. The group consists of eleven men, standing and kneeling, with a grassy field and a building in the background.

(Brian, 4th from left on the back row)

Brian (Stace) was a miserly line and length bowler who wore his heart on his sleeve and was a winner but also enjoyed the social side with the opposition after the game.

Brian was part of the DCC team that won the prestigious Senior Charity and Myers Burnell cups in the 70s.

In 1986 he won the Top Division bowling award with 34 wickets @ 11.35 and in 1994 won the Div 4 bowling award with 40 wickets @ 10.15

We will miss you Bri, you gave us many great memories on and off the pitch.

RIP Brian a true legend of Dunnington Cricket Club.
